Description
Villa Avenia is a 5 minute walk form the port of Salerno, connected from April until October by maritime lines with the Amalfi coast and the Cilentan coast and with the islands of Ischia and Capri.

The splendid cathedral of Salerno ed and the primary historical monuments of the city are located within 1km from our home.

The city centre and the best shops are located are only a few steps away, where are also situated the primary bus stops for the lines reaching the archaeological sites of Pompei, Ercolano and Paestum. A precious gem nestled within a crown, Villa Avenia looks out upon the marvellous gulf, laying at the feet of the historical Garden of Minerva.

Recently restructured, Villa Avenia offers it’s guests the warmth of home and an elegance of simplicity which are appreciated by those who possess a true taste for tradition and authenticity. Wellbeing and quality of life are traditions which still today remain alive in the spirit and hospitality of it’s owners.

The owner, Dr. Pino Monaco, naturopathic doctor, personally cultivates the gardens of Villa Avenia and sees to the production of his organic olive oil.

His wife, Mrs. Paola Pagano, takes care of every guest and prepares rich and delicious breakfasts.

ulrike
Property: 5 | Cleaning: 6 | Host: 9 | Location: 7 | Price/Quality: 3 | Breakfast: 2
The stay was mixed. The address is Via Torquato Tasso, not Via Tasso. The building is located in the traffic-calmed old town. In itself only accessible by foot. However, this is not clear from the description. Once there, it is very convenient. The train station for trains to Paestum or Pompeii is also within a 10-minute walk. We had a very small dark room facing the street. Everything was full of the landlady's personal belongings, there was no space for our clothes. There was no breakfast in the house, we had to go to a café where there was only the basics, coffee and a sweet treat. Even juice would have cost extra. The landlady was very friendly and her friends were also very open and helpful.

The bed-and-breakfast Villa Avenia in Salerno is a nice, first-rate address located in an antique palazzo in the oldest part of the city in a narrow street in the pedestrian zone. The rooms are nice, clean, large and comfortable with a magnificent view to the gulf of Salerno and the historic city. The bathroom is integrated into the room in a functional and nice manner. Everything is very comfortable and clean. The host speaks English, is very helpful and immediately addresses all questions. We were very cordially received during our stay and our host always had suggestions for sightseeing and activities. The breakfast is superb, served in a nice salon equipped with old furnitures. It includes all kinds of different local and italian food including mozzarella, cheese, fresh fruits, cakes and a lot more deli food. We enjoyed our stay in Villa Avenia very much and will certainly come back.

rosanne
Property: 10 | Cleaning: 10 | Host: 10 | Location: 9 | Price/Quality: 9 | Breakfast: 10
Our first evening in Italy was spent in this charming B&B after a long travel day. It was restful, quiet, and had all the amenities. We opened the door on our balcony and were stunned by the view of the Mediterranean framed by the fragrant jasmine on the railing. Elena made delicious cake for us for breakfast, along with fresh squeezed blood orange juice. Pots of coffee and hot water - the best breakfast we had the whole time we were in Italy. I loved this part of Italy, where you could get escarole on your pizza, and unique seafood. Be warned that dinner starts after 9pm! With jet lag we never were able to stay up for "dinner" so we had big lunches and pizza in the evening. This is a great jumping off point for a boat ride to Amalfi, and a train ride to Pastum, which we did in one day. If you have more time there is lots more to explore (and limoncello to drink). Thank you beautiful Elena! I loved the heritage of your building and your care of it.

davinia
Property: 10 | Cleaning: 10 | Host: 10 | Location: 9 | Price/Quality: 10 | Breakfast: 9
We thoroughly enjoyed our stay at the Villa Avenia. The Villa itself is beautiful, charming, well maintained and has breathtaking views of Salerno. We loved our room and bathroom was great - no problems at all. The beds were okay - not very comfortable, but comfortable enough. The breakfast was simple and included some homemade treats along with fruits, packaged yoghurts, and fresh coffee. We wondered through the old part of town near the villa both days and stumbled on some lovely restaurants. Our favorite place was Salerhum - A small Rum/Cocktail bar a short walk off a main thoroughfare in the old town. Where we spent the most enjoyable night of our two week vacation around Europe. The hotel staff - specifically a very friendly girl, was very helpful with advice on how to travel to the neighboring Amalfi and Positano and also researched train times for us for our next destination. The hotel is somewhat conveniently located just at the top of the public elevator/lift which made it easy to get straight into the main old town Salerno. Beware of the closing/opening hours! When it's closed it's easy enough to walk - but maybe not ideal with luggage to drag uphill. The roads are too narrow for cars. We loved it - a highlight of our trip.
